2004 Honda Civic | 2010 Peugeot 5008 | |
Make | Honda | Peugeot |
Model | Civic | 5008 |
Year Released | 2004 | 2010 |
Body Type | Coupe | Minivan |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1599 cc | 1997 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 116 HP | 148 HP |
Engine RPM | 5500 RPM | 3750 RPM |
Torque | 144 Nm | 340 Nm |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 7 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4440 mm | 4530 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1700 mm | 1835 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1410 mm | 1640 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2630 mm | 2735 mm |
